Upon completion of the program, kids receive a Catoctin Mountain Park Junior Ranger badge.
CATOCTIN MOUNTAIN PARK JUNIOR RANGER PROGRAM A self discovery workbook to be completed at the park Visitor Center and includes one trail activity. Park wildlife and cultural resources are explored through stories, fill-in the blank, puzzles, and games. A junior ranger badge will be awarded upon completion and review with a ranger of the workbook.The Junior Ranger Program promotes stewardship and protection of Catoctin Mountain Park, a unit of the National Park Service. Estimated time to complete the Program is approximately 1 hour for the workbook and 1 hour for the trail portion of the program. Ages 6-8 (pdf file) and Ages 9-11(pdf file).
